Jean Bassères (born May 22, 1960) is a French high ranking civil servant and former interim director of Sciences Po.[1] He previously served as the director general of France Travail from December 15, 2011 until December 15, 2023.[2]
Biography
Early life and education
A graduate of Sciences Po, Bassères went on to study at the École nationale d'administration from 1984 until 1986.
Professional life
On March 26, 2024, Bassères was named the interim director of the Institut d'études politiques de Paris (Sciences Po) and the interim administrator of Fondation nationale des sciences politiques (FNSP).[1] He served until the appointment of Luis Vassy on September 20, 2024.
